The moon will try another step in its dance with the shadow of our earth today at 00:57.27 AM, Pacific Daylight Time. A full lunar eclipse can only happen with a full moon. The moon appears full for a number of days each cycle every month, however, it is only completely full for a number of hours in each cycle. This can allow for a partial eclipse such as the one today. The 97 % and change eclipse will start at 10:00 PM PST on the 18th and end at 4:06 AM on the 19th
A lunar eclipse can only take place during the full moon. During a partial lunar eclipse, the Moon is partially covered by the shadow of the Earth and starts changing color to copper-red. This partial lunar eclipse will be visible in North, Central and South America, Asia and Australia. In Europe and Africa it will be partially visible. It can’t be seen in the Middle and Near East. It will be the longest partial lunar eclipse since the 15th century.

The fall equinox marks the end of summer, it can be anywhere from September 21st to 24th, there has not been a September 21st equinox for thousands of years. this highlights the weight of time that went in to the orbit cycles and its consistency
Twenty one past noon, British Columbia
At 3:21 PM Eastern time the earth will enjoy 12 hrs light and 12 hours dark as the days start to move to the Winter Solstice, then the northern hemisphere tips its full 23 degrees away from the sun making the shortest daylight in that 24 hour cycle on December 21st 2021, in 91 days.
No its not your pet it is the the dog star, Sirius, Canis Majoros, its the star the ancients waited to see come above the horizon so it was safe to plant along the Nile river because that God was watching over them.
That star is more that 2 solar mass’s and 10,000 degrees Celsius on its surface making it the brightest star in the night sky.
Mid August helical rising above the horizon in north America should see it come into view in the eastern sky before sunrise.

Cooling for the night.
Soak your pillow cases in cold tap water ring them out and dry some before bedtime. Maybe sheets too. Or put them in the fridge to cool them down before going to bed.
Bucket of cold water to put your feet in if you wake.
Close blinds and curtains during day.
Ensure your fans are pushing air optimally not hot air that has risen to the ceiling down to your living space.
